What Determines the Clinical Course and Outcome of DPPX Encephalitis? A Systematic Review

Background:
Dipeptidyl peptidase like protein 6 (DPPX) encephalitis is a rare type of autoimmune encephalitis. It presents with a plethora of clinical manifestations and variable disease course.
Objectives:
The aim of this systematic review is to study the course of DPPX encephalitis, response to various immunotherapies and determine factors that can predict clinical outcome and relapse.
Methods:
Search was performed in the PUBMED and Web of Science database for studies published until December 15, 2025. Univariate analysis and multiple regression modeling were used to analyze predictors affecting the outcome and relapse.
Results:
Treatment details were available in 66 patients. Favorable clinical improvement was observed in 74.24% (n = 49) patients. Among these patients, 18 patients recovered completely with first line immunotherapy and short course of steroids with no relapse until the last follow up while 48 patients were treated with long term immunotherapy. Stratified multivariable regression analysis revealed that, among patients who lacked hyperekplexia, good response to first line immunotherapy (OR = 13.20, 95% CI = 1.89-91.91, p = 0.009) was associated with favorable clinical outcome. However, among patients with hyperekplexia, presence of good response to first line immunotherapy did not predict favorable outcome. CSF abnormality (OR = 14.00, 95% CI: 1.69-115.79, p = 0.02) and hyperekplexia (OR = 4.40, 95% CI: 1.37-14.11, p = 0.01) predicted higher propensity for relapse.
Conclusion:
Recognition of hyperekplexia could be imperative in prognosticating patients with respect to need for long term immunotherapy and course of illness. This study also postulates the possibility of monophasic illness in a subgroup of patients with DPPX encephalitis.
